Using a putty knife, you are going to apply the resin to the hole. It's important to use as much ceramic tile filler as the hole will allow. You want to fill the hole entirely and get the patch level to the shower or tub wall. Make sure to let the entire filler dry. It should be stable when you touch the filler.

There are a few ways to fix a hole in a hot tub. The most common is to use a vinyl patch kit, which can be purchased at most hardware stores. The kit will come with everything you need to make the repair, including adhesive and patches in different sizes.
Overused or old water. Clean the filters. Shock the spa water with sanitizer. Add sanitizer as your owner's manual recommends; adjust the pH and/or the alkalinity to the recommended range. Run the jet pumps and clean the filters. Drain and refill the spa.

To remove the jet, simply insert a finger into the center hole of the jet and snap it out. Don't worry, your finger will remain intact. Use a gentle soap and water solution to clean out the jet. On the inside of the spa, apply a ¼-inch thick ring of 100 percent silicone around the site where the jet connects to the spa wall. Push the jet firmly into place, and retighten the retaining nut and screws. Wipe off excess silicone. Allow 24 hours for the silicone to dry before using the spa.
Heal it with heat. Most plastics will melt and reharden when you apply heat. Use a soldering iron or a heated butter knife to carefully melt plastic around the hole. Use the soldering iron or knife or another tool, like a putty knife, to work the melted plastic into place to seal the hole. Smooth out the material as best you can.
